- /*
- * Tests if binary strings are supported.
- */
-
- #include "config.h"
- #include <stdio.h>
- #include <string.h>
-
- #include "json_inttypes.h"
- #include "json_object.h"
- #include "json_tokener.h"
-
- int main(void)
- {
- /* this test has embedded null characters in the key and value.
- * check that it's still included after deserializing. */
- const char *input = "{ \"biff\\u0000\": null, \"\\u0000zxcvbnm\": 178 }";
- const char *expected_biff = "biff\0";
- const int expected_biff_len = 5;
- const char *expected_biff_printable = "biff\\u0000";
- const char *expected_zxcv = "\0zxcvbnm";
- const int expected_zxcv_len = 8;
- const char *expected_zxcv_printable = "\\u0000zxcvbnm";
-
- struct json_object *parsed = json_tokener_parse(input);
- struct json_object *val;
- json_bool key_present;
-
- printf("Parsed input: %s\n", input);
- printf("Result is ");
- if (parsed == NULL)
- {
- printf("NULL (error!)\n");
- return 1; // Error somewhere
- }
- else if (!json_object_is_type(parsed, json_type_object))
- {
- printf("not `json_type_object` (error!)\n");
- return 1; // Error somewhere
- }
- else
- {
- printf("`json_type_object`\n");
- }
-
- // Check nothing odd happened in parsing
- if (json_object_object_length(parsed) != 2)
- {
- printf("Should contain two fields (has %d) (error!)",
- json_object_object_length(parsed));
- return 1;
- }
-
- key_present = json_object_object_get_ex_len(parsed, expected_biff, expected_biff_len, &val);
- if (!key_present || !json_object_is_type(val, json_type_null))
- {
- printf("The key \"%s\" should be present and should be NULL (error!)\n",
- expected_biff_printable);
- return 1;
- }
- key_present = json_object_object_get_ex_len(parsed, expected_zxcv, expected_zxcv_len, &val);
- if (!key_present || !json_object_is_type(val, json_type_int) ||
- json_object_get_int(val) != 178)
- {
- printf("The key \"%s\" should be present and should be 178 (error!)\n",
- expected_zxcv_printable);
- return 1;
- }
- printf("Expected keys (\"%s\" and \"%s\") present with expected values\n",
- expected_biff_printable, expected_zxcv_printable);
-
- // Delete one key
- json_object_object_del_len(parsed, expected_zxcv, expected_zxcv_len);
-
- // Check it is gone
- if (json_object_object_length(parsed) != 1)
- {
- printf("Should contain only one field (has %d) (error!)",
- json_object_object_length(parsed));
- return 1;
- }
- key_present = json_object_object_get_ex_len(parsed, expected_biff, expected_biff_len, &val);
- if (!key_present || !json_object_is_type(val, json_type_null))
- {
- printf("The key \"%s\" should be present and should be NULL (error!)\n",
- expected_biff_printable);
- return 1;
- }
- key_present = json_object_object_get_ex_len(parsed, expected_zxcv, expected_zxcv_len, &val);
- if (key_present)
- {
- printf("The key \"%s\" should not be present (error!)\n", expected_zxcv_printable);
- return 1;
- }
- printf("Key deleted properly\n");
-
- json_object_put(parsed);
- printf("PASS\n");
- return 0;
- }
